About Crags Campground

Campground in Idaho.

Nestled in the heart of Idaho's stunning wilderness, Crags Campground offers RV travelers an authentic mountain camping experience surrounded by pristine natural beauty. This public campground provides the perfect base for exploring some of the Pacific Northwest's most spectacular landscapes, where towering peaks and dense forests create an atmosphere of true solitude and tranquility.

The Idaho backcountry surrounding Crags Campground is a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ts of all types. Hikers will find countless trails ranging from leisurely nature walks to challenging alpine adventures, each offering breathtaking views and opportunities to connect with the region's remarkable wilderness. The area's clear mountain streams and lakes provide excellent opportunities for fishing, with native cutthroat trout and other species making this a favorite destination for both fly-fishers and traditional anglers. The cooler mountain elevation means refreshing temperatures even during summer months, making it an ideal escape from the heat of lower elevations.

Wildlife viewing is a memorable part of staying at this location, with opportunities to observe mule deer, elk, and various bird species in their natural habitat. The landscape itself tells the story of Idaho's geological history, with dramatic rock formations and scenic vistas that make every sunrise and sunset special. Photography enthusiasts will find endless subject matter, from wildflower meadows in season to panoramic mountain views.
